Job description
Reporting to the Assistant Director for Library Systems, the Discovery Systems and Electronic Resources Specialist supports the discovery and access of the library’s resources. The position provides support for electronic resource troubleshooting and discovery services. This role works closely with other Digital Library and Technical Services teams (Acquisitions, Metadata, and Collection Services) and consults with public services teams to enhance how users find, access, evaluate, and use library, archives, and special collections resources within the primary library catalog and related applications. The position supports the technology that connects faculty and students with library materials. The position requires strong analytical judgment, systems thinking, documentation skills, and the ability to translate access problems, metadata issues, usage data, and user behavior into practical service improvements. Work will directly contribute to resolving access and discovery challenges, making a meaningful difference for library users on all global New School campuses. CORE CAPABILITIES, PRIMARY DUTIES, AND RESPONSIBILITIES, Discovery & Electronic Resource Support
- Monitor and analyze catalog and electronic resource usage
- Troubleshoot electronic resource access (OpenAthens) and metadata issues
- Recommend and implement discovery and supporting system improvements
- Coordinate with university, consortial, and vendor support departments
- Create and review documentation for library staff
- Facilitate import of new digital collections and secure electronic lending within the discovery interface.
- Collaborate with colleagues in the Libraries, Archives, and other areas of the university
- Enrich and load metadata for electronic/digital library materials in consultation with the Metadata and Collection Services team.
- Collect, analyze, and present data from various sources

Requirements
- Required
- Bachelor’s degree and relevant professional experience,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Experience supporting electronic resources, discovery systems, metadata workflows, library systems, scholarly communications, or academic information services.
- Experience with data integrations, APIs, or automated workflows
-
Strong analytical and problem-solving skills
- Preferred
- Master’s degree in Library and Information Science, information management, data analytics, educational technology, publishing, or a related field.
- Demonstrated experience with Ex Libris Alma/Primo, or comparable library service platforms (
as an example). * Experience with Digital Asset Management systems such as ContentDM or Alma-D/Specto
- Familiarity with specific standards: COUNTER, SUSHI, KBART, and OpenURL
- Ability to read, adapt, or troubleshoot basic scripts (Python and/or JavaScript), structured data, or configuration files in support of library systems and electronic resource workflows.
